Abstract

A ballistic resistant case for a secondary battery having a rectangular metal case () with a panel () connected to the bottom wall and the side walls to divide the internal space of the case into cell pack receiving bays (). A bus bar () extends from the front wall, across the top of the panel, to the rear wall. A connector () secures the cover () to the panel () with the bus bar () sandwiched therebetween. The bus bar () reinforces a central portion of the cover () and prevents the panel () and the walls from deflecting to provide ballistic protection for the cell packs ().
